Transaction ed886468feee4a16d5d33d91fab4cb8c79b1402788fba63dae29a5cb606d2afc

1 Input
2 Outputs
  • ed886468feee4a16d5d33d91fab4cb8c79b1402788fba63dae29a5cb606d2afc:0
  • value  656287
    address  3PEVH3q15gavo2AvjvWDssow7coAiKZePg
  • ed886468feee4a16d5d33d91fab4cb8c79b1402788fba63dae29a5cb606d2afc:1
  • value  31631417
    address  bc1qxa5hh9rnejfc9rqe3yst87qhy80ma80dyw5naqyul6nhk73zjd3q4kr8te